Understanding the Layout of Dr. Terror's House of Horrors

The sheer complexity of Dr. Terror's House of Horrors is part of its terrifying allure. It's less a house and more a sprawling, disorienting maze designed to discombobulate and frighten. Understanding its layout is crucial for survival.

Mapping the Maze

The house’s winding corridors, sudden dead ends, and cleverly concealed passages will leave you questioning your sanity. While a detailed map may not be provided, you can significantly improve your chances by employing a few simple techniques.

  • Remember key landmarks: Focus on unique visual cues—a stained-glass window, a peculiar piece of furniture, an unusual painting—to help track your progress.
  • Count your turns: Keep track of the number of left and right turns you make to aid backtracking if you become lost.
  • Look for clues: Dr. Terror often leaves behind cryptic clues within the environment. Pay attention to these – they might reveal shortcuts or warn of impending scares.
  • Teamwork makes the dream work: If you're going with friends, assign roles like a "navigator" and a "spotter" to enhance your awareness and effectiveness.

Mastering the Psychological Tricks of Dr. Terror's House of Horrors

Dr. Terror is a master manipulator. He leverages psychological techniques to amplify your fear response.

Recognizing Psychological Manipulation

The house expertly uses sound, lighting, and sudden movements to create a sense of unease and dread.

  • Sound Design: Expect sudden loud noises, whispers, and unsettling musical cues to unsettle you. Try not to jump at every sound, instead maintaining awareness and remaining calm.
  • Lighting: Sudden shifts from bright to dark, strobing lights, and strategically placed shadows are all meant to disorient and frighten. Maintain a steady light source to lessen disorientation.
  • Jump Scares: These are designed to catch you off guard. Maintain situational awareness to anticipate possible jump scares, and keep your composure.

Maintaining Mental Fortitude

Managing fear is essential for conquering Dr. Terror's House of Horrors.

  • Deep Breathing: Practice deep, controlled breaths to calm your nervous system.
  • Positive Self-Talk: Remind yourself that it’s just a house, and that the scares are designed to be intense but not physically dangerous.
  • Focus on the experience: Rather than let fear consume you, concentrate on observing the details and the artistry of the house's scares.

Essential Equipment and Strategies for Dr. Terror's House of Horrors

Preparation is key to surviving Dr. Terror's domain.

What to Bring (and What to Leave Behind)

Choosing the right gear can dramatically enhance your experience.

  • Flashlight: A strong flashlight is invaluable for navigating the dark corridors. Avoid using your phone's flashlight, as it may not be powerful enough.
  • Comfortable clothing: Wear comfortable, practical clothes that allow for easy movement. Avoid restrictive clothing or high heels.
  • A group: Visiting with friends enhances the experience – it's better to face Dr. Terror with support!

Teamwork and Communication

Communication is crucial, particularly in a group.

  • Verbal cues: Use quiet, concise words to warn your companions of potential hazards.
  • Non-verbal communication: Utilize gestures to indicate dangers or points of interest without drawing unnecessary attention to yourself.
  • Stay together: Remain close to your group to share your awareness and support one another.
